Abstract

The present utility model discloses an anti-slip clinical thermometer, which is relative to medical equipment, has convenient use and fit operation, and is anti-slip and safe. Contents of the technical scheme are as following: the clinical thermometer includes a glass column and a mercury containing cavity at lower end; and heat-conductive and transparent hose is fitted on the lower half section of the glass column and the mercury containing cavity. The present design is suitable for various glass column-type clinical thermometers.

Description

The anti-slip thermometer
Technical field:
The utility model is relevant with medical appliance, specifically is meant thermometer.
Background technology:
Thermometer is the bound a kind of apparatus of measuring human body temperature of occasions such as medical space even family; Traditional thermometer mainly is made up of the glass of one section hollow Sheng mercury cavity volume prismatic and a termination; Though along with the utensil of the various take temperatures of development of modern technologies has occurred a lot, this traditional thermometer is can't be substituted because of its characteristics good and cheap, easy and simple to handle at short notice still; Because this apparatus is a glass material; The smooth very easy slippage in surface in the use; Also usually can give more incompatibility of people a kind of very uncomfortable feeling, particularly child greatly when simultaneously this material contact with human body because of the temperature difference, more than these problems be sought after the consideration solution.
Summary of the invention:
The purpose of the utility model is that a kind of thermometric new technical scheme is provided is the anti-slip thermometer, and it can eliminate above-mentioned inconvenience.
Theing contents are as follows of the utility model technical scheme: it comprises the Sheng mercury cavity volume of glass column and lower end, and the lower semisection of said glass column and Sheng mercury dissolve the chamber upper sleeve through has heat conduction and transparent sebific duct.
The beneficial effect of the utility model is anti-skidding safety.
Description of drawings:
Fig. 1 is the thermometric front elevation of anti-slip.
Among the figure, 1 is glass column, and 2 is sebific duct, and 3 for containing the mercury cavity volume.
Embodiment:
As shown in Figure 1; With heat conduction and transparency preferably silica gel material make rugosity and the moderate sebific duct 2 of sebific duct wall thickness and be bound by the lower semisection of glass column 1 and contain on the mercury cavity volume 3; Because thermometric lower semisection is and the contacted part of human body; Traditional this thermometer regular meeting when placing human body surface to measure is smooth once do not note can landing because of this part; And the outstanding non-skid property in colloidal materials surface can make the apparatus that this easy landing of thermometer falls damage easily can slippage; The heat-conducting effect of heat conductive silica gel material does not influence the measurement of body temperature basically yet preferably, the discomfort that the contrast that its surface contacted with body surface when reduction that simultaneously also can be suitable was measured is brought, and safety is comfortable again.

Claims (1)

1. anti-slip thermometer, it comprises the Sheng mercury cavity volume of glass column and lower end, it is characterized in that the lower semisection of glass column and contain mercury dissolving the chamber upper sleeve through heat conduction and transparent sebific duct being arranged.
